In recent years, wearable technology has moved far beyond fitness trackers and smartwatches. One of the most promising innovations in this space is the smart helmet, a piece of protective headgear enhanced with digital features that improve safety, communication, and efficiency. Unlike traditional helmets, which serve only as a physical barrier against injury, smart helmets integrate sensors, connectivity, and real-time data to create a more intelligent form of protection. The Core Features of Smart Helmets Built-in communication systems: Many smart helmets are equipped with Bluetooth or wireless intercoms, allowing workers, cyclists, or motorcyclists to stay connected without removing their helmets. Augmented reality (AR) displays: Some advanced models project navigation instructions, hazard warnings, or worksite data directly onto a visor, reducing the need to look away from the task at hand. Environmental sensors: These can detect temperature, air quality, or the presence of harmful gases, particularly useful in industrial or mining environments. Impact detection: Accelerometers and gyroscopes can sense sudden impacts, automatically alerting emergency services if an accident occurs. Smart lighting and cameras: Integrated cameras record surroundings for safety audits or accident analysis, while adaptive lighting improves visibility in low-light conditions. These features transform the helmet from a passive safety device into an active guardian, capable of preventing accidents and improving response times when emergencies occur.
Applications Across Industries Construction and industrial sites: Workers benefit from real-time hazard alerts, communication tools, and monitoring of environmental conditions. Supervisors can track helmet data to ensure compliance with safety protocols. Motorcycling and cycling: Navigation assistance, hands-free calls, and crash detection improve both convenience and safety for riders. Some helmets even connect to smartphones for music or voice commands. Sports and recreation: In activities like skiing or mountain biking, smart helmets provide performance tracking, video recording, and emergency alerts in case of falls. Healthcare and rehabilitation: Certain helmets are being developed to monitor brain activity or detect early signs of concussion, offering valuable insights for athletes and patients alike.
Benefits and Challenges However, challenges remain. High costs can limit widespread adoption, especially in industries with tight budgets. Privacy concerns also arise, as helmets that track location or record video may be seen as intrusive by workers. Additionally, the durability of electronic components in harsh environments is a technical hurdle that manufacturers must overcome.
